Indoor air quality is essential for maintaining a wholesome living environment. Many individuals spend a significant period of time indoors, making understanding the common factors affecting indoor air quality essential for total well-being. Poor air quality can lead to various well being issues, including respiratory issues, allergies, and other long-term situations.


One of the primary contributors to indoor air quality is ventilation. Proper air flow helps flow into fresh air within an area, diluting pollutants and moisture. Insufficient ventilation can trap contaminants, resulting in increased concentrations of airborne toxins. Homes and buildings which are too tightly sealed for vitality efficiency can end result in poor airflow, emphasizing the necessity for balanced air flow systems.


Another essential issue is the presence of indoor pollutants. These can come from a variety of sources, together with household cleaners, paints, and pesticides. Volatile natural compounds, or VOCs, are commonly found in many family merchandise. When these merchandise are used or stored improperly, they'll release harmful gases into the air, contributing to compromised indoor air quality.


Humidity levels significantly influence air quality as nicely. High humidity can create a breeding ground for mould, mud mites, and other allergens. Conversely, low humidity can lead to dry pores and skin and respiratory discomfort. It's essential to maintain optimum humidity ranges, typically between 30% and 50%, to advertise a cushty and wholesome indoor setting.

Household dust can harbor a selection of allergens, together with pet dander, pollen, and dirt mite droppings. Regular cleaning routines play a big function in reducing mud ranges. Vacuuming carpets, wiping surfaces, and using air purifiers may help mitigate dust-related points in indoor areas.


The use of combustion home equipment, similar to stoves and heaters, can also affect indoor air quality. While these devices are helpful for heating and cooking, they'll launch harmful emissions if not vented properly. Carbon monoxide is a significant risk from poorly maintained appliances. Regular inspections and maintenance are needed to ensure these methods operate safely and don't contribute to indoor air pollution.

Similar to combustion appliances, constructing supplies can also negatively impression indoor air quality. Certain supplies, such as asbestos and formaldehyde, can release dangerous particles into the air. When considering renovations or new constructions, choosing low-emission supplies can considerably decrease the presence of dangerous substances. This proactive method contributes to a more healthy indoor setting.


Lifestyle decisions additionally influence indoor air quality. The presence of pets can contribute to increased allergens within the air. While pet possession brings joy to many, it comes with the responsibility of managing dander and hair. Implementing common grooming and cleaning can minimize the negative impact pets could have on air quality.


Air filtration techniques are a worthwhile funding for bettering indoor air quality. Using HEPA filters can successfully seize particles that cause allergic reactions and other respiratory issues. These filters can lure dust, pollen, and even some bacteria and viruses, helping to click for source purify the indoor air.


The impact of outside air quality shouldn't be ignored. Factors such as vehicle emissions, industrial air pollution, and pesticides can infiltrate indoor areas. Keeping home windows closed during high air pollution periods and utilizing air purifiers may help mitigate a few of these external influences.

How usually ought to I change air filters in my HVAC system for optimal air quality?


Typically, it's beneficial to alter HVAC air filters every 1-3 months, relying on utilization and the type of filter. Regular maintenance helps ensure the system operates effectively and improves indoor air quality.
